]> de.git.xonotic.org Git - xonotic/xonotic-data.pk3dir.git/blobdiff - qcsrc/csqcmodellib/sv_model.qc
Merge branch 'master' of /var/cache/git/xonotic/xonotic-data.pk3dir
[xonotic/xonotic-data.pk3dir.git] / qcsrc / csqcmodellib / sv_model.qc
index 1c214e0aba78780aabf153c2437966ca0c20b848..bf6eefa6971b0b0c3f9687c61e60608e9e13ff3d 100644 (file)
@@ -92,7 +92,7 @@ void CSQCModel_CheckUpdate()
        }
 #define CSQCMODEL_PROPERTY_SCALED(flag,t,r,w,f,s,mi,ma) \
        { \
-               t tmp = bound(mi, s * self.f, ma); \
+               t tmp = bound(mi, s * self.f, ma) - mi; \
                if(tmp != self.csqcmodel_##f) \
                { \
                        self.csqcmodel_##f = tmp; \
@@ -110,6 +110,7 @@ void CSQCModel_LinkEntity()
 {
        self.SendEntity = CSQCModel_Send;
        self.SendFlags = 0xFFFFFF;
+       CSQCModel_CheckUpdate();
 }
 
 void CSQCModel_UnlinkEntity()